When I did the Avon Walk a couple of years ago, I was in your shoes - about a month away and over $1k to raise. I had the help of a good friend and we did two things: 1 - We asked our local Wal-Mart to let us set up a table outside their store on a busy weekend. We had gotten some pink ribbon and some lace ribbon from a craft store and glued the ribbon together with the lace as a border. We gave the ribbons to those people who gave a donation of $1 or more. 2 - Harder, but more effective. We basically hit the sidewalks and went door to door. We explained that I was doing the Avon Walk and the story behind my walk (I was walking in memory of my mom). While some people were rude, others were amazingly generous. Again, gave the ribbons away to those who donated. I had created a flyer with my name and address, plus the link to the web site where they could make a donation directly (in case they felt leery about giving money to a stranger). If you live in a smaller community, you might try the local radio stations to get some PR. In the end we were able to raise about $3k and my Avon Walk experience will always be a great memory.
